Water Parameters

When it comes to Cryptocoryne Nevillii, maintaining stable water parameters is essential for their growth and overall health. In my experience, these aquatic plants are quite adaptable, but it’s still important to keep their preferred environment in mind.

The ideal temperature for Cryptocoryne Nevillii ranges between 22°C to 28°C (72°F to 82°F). They can tolerate some fluctuations, but I’ve had the most success when keeping the temperature within this range.

For pH, these plants prefer slightly acidic to neutral water. The recommended pH range lies between 6.0 and 7.5. I once had a tank with pH close to 8.0 and noticed my Cryptocoryne Nevillii struggling a bit, so I’d advise keeping the pH closer to their preferred range.

It’s important to regularly test and monitor these water parameters to ensure they remain stable. I usually do this weekly and take necessary measures to adjust the parameters if they fall outside the desired ranges.

Lighting Requirements

Cryptocoryne Nevillii thrives in low to medium light conditions. Using LED lights can provide the necessary spectrum for its growth. It’s essential to maintain consistency in lighting to avoid algae growth.

I once had a Cryptocoryne Nevillii that struggled because I didn’t take the light requirements seriously. With the right adjustments, it flourished in no time!

For ideal lighting, aim for a PAR value of 20-40 µmol/m²/s. This intensity allows the plant to perform photosynthesis effectively without causing stress.

Be mindful of the duration of light exposure, too. Approximately 10-12 hours per day should suffice. A simple timer can help regulate the schedule.

Growth Rate and Propagation

Cryptocoryne Nevillii is a slow-growing plant. I remember when I first started caring for this species, I wanted it to grow faster, but patience is key. Its growth rate allows it to adapt well to various aquarium conditions.

Propagation for this plant is quite easy. Cryptocoryne Nevillii develops small runners at the base, which give rise to new plants. These baby plants are called daughter plants.

When the daughter plants form a good root system and a few leaves, you can separate them from the parent plant. Don’t worry, this won’t harm either plant as long as you do it gently.

An alternative method of propagation is through tissue cultures. This technique is popular in the aquarium industry as it allows mass production of Cryptocoryne species.

Crypt Melt and Prevention

Crypt Melt is a common issue faced by aquarists when planting Cryptocoryne Nevillii. It refers to the significant melting and dying of the plant leaves. Preventing it is essential to maintain a healthy and thriving aquatic environment.

One of the leading causes of crypt melt is the sudden change in water parameters. Monitor and maintain stable pH, temperature, and hardness to avoid this issue. Keep the water clean and clear to reduce the growth of algae.

Fertilization is essential for healthy growth, but overfeeding may lead to an algae outbreak. I experienced this issue once, and it severely damaged my Cryptocoryne Nevillii plants. Stick to a balanced feeding schedule and be sure to remove excess nutrients and debris.

Proper lighting is vital for maintaining a thriving aquatic environment. Provide a suitable light spectrum and duration to support the growth of your Cryptocoryne Nevillii plants. Excessive lighting may encourage algae growth and contribute to crypt melt.

By carefully considering these factors, it is possible to prevent crypt melt and promote the healthy growth of your Cryptocoryne Nevillii plants. Remember that consistency is key in maintaining an ideal aquatic environment.
